Output 34d748bfbe5d23de8c7e0e2de31cb97ecc6f5f53d3c0c63fc9f2387d96bb5337:0

value
42607328
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50f67b14ee56b661109e28d495477fc7db619ba5 OP_EQUAL
address
3957Fg8uok2sq1evarc84VqH2zVsR4jkra
transaction
34d748bfbe5d23de8c7e0e2de31cb97ecc6f5f53d3c0c63fc9f2387d96bb5337
spent
true